Col de la Cou
Col de la Cou is a mountain saddle in Saint-Étienne-de-Crossey, Arrondissement of Grenoble,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es and has an elevation of 545 metres. Col de la Cou is situated nearby to the hamlet La Gratonnière, as well as near the locality Montmain.Places of Interest

Voiron
Photo: Creative Commons, CC BY 3.0.
Voiron is a city in Isère, France. The city is at the foot of the Chartreuse, a mountain chain in Alps, so that is convenient for winter sports.

Saint-Nicolas-de-Macherin
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Saint-Nicolas-de-Macherin is a commune in the Isère department within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es in southeastern France. The area of the commune is 1,060 hectares and the altitude lies between 447 and 952 meters.
